New League of Legends, Valorant Feature Limits Players’ Options

League of Legends and Valorant have implemented brand-new parental features aimed at protecting children, though the features are reportedly producing unintended side effects. Players are reporting unexpected restrictions on everything from League of Legends‘ chat system to friend requests.

Parental controls and child protection have rapidly become major talking points in modern gaming. The advent of social media and online games has seen many governing bodies raise concerns about protecting children from interacting with strangers. Many consoles and games have begun implementing age verification requirements for players to be given full access to chat features, with some countries like France even pushing to ban minors from using social media platforms. Parental controls have also been a growing measure for many games to restrict younger children, with Riot Games now following suit with its own changes.

Riot Games Implements Parental Controls in League, Valorant, TFT

  • Turn text and voice chat off or limit to friends
  • Prevent sending or accepting friend requests
  • Restrict or disable access to specific Riot games

Recent changes to League of Legends, Valorant, and TFT have introduced a slew of new parental controls to the games. The official update gives parents the option to limit text and voice chat to friends or restrict it entirely, prevent sending or accepting friend requests, and even disabling access to some games. However, Riot’s new parental controls have reportedly had a far broader impact on League of Legends players, with many reporting being erroneously restricted from using chat features. Users have claimed that the feature was automatically enabled upon release, causing many adult users to wrongly be blocked. One user even reported that their 16-year-old account had been blocked, with no way to disable the feature.

The controversial parental controls saw many fans of League of Legends and Valorant unable to access their longstanding accounts. The change affected many adult users who had already provided their date of birth on their Riot account, suggesting that the parental controls were affecting all users. Riot Games later made an official statement about the change improperly affecting many League of Legends accounts, confirming that it would be rolling back the change specifically on League in order to address the issues. Some users even suggested that the parental email verification system was not functioning properly.

The implementation of parental controls in Riot Games titles received plenty of scrutiny from fans of the games. The change was particularly criticized in Valorant, which already has a T (Teen) rating from the US-based ESRB and a 16+ rating from European ratings board PEGI. League of Legends was given a lighter PEGI 12+ rating for its in-game content, with the same T rating with the ESRB. One reply in the comments to the announcement post even pointed out that Riot’s new parental system was the only existing way to block incoming friend requests.

Riot Games’ newest controversy comes as the company’s flagship game gears up for a huge new release in July. The studio officially teased League of Legends Classic in June as a new game mode bringing back old items, Champions, and a previous map design for Summoner’s Rift. The initial iteration of the game mode is based around the gameplay from League of Legends‘ Season 3, and features older pre-rework versions of Champions like Nidalee, Sion, and Evelynn. Riot Games can only hope that its parental control fiasco doesn’t serve to dampen the hype behind its nostalgic new game mode.
